首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用Vue.Js / Inertia.js和Laravel对结果进行分页

使用Vue.js / Inertia.js和Laravel对结果进行分页是一种常见的前后端分离开发方式,可以提供更好的用户体验和性能优化。下面是对这个问题的完善且全面的答案:

  1. Vue.js:
    • 概念:Vue.js是一套用于构建用户界面的渐进式JavaScript框架,通过组件化的方式构建交互式的Web界面。
    • 分类:Vue.js属于前端开发框架,用于构建用户界面。
    • 优势:Vue.js具有简单易学、灵活性强、性能高效、生态丰富等优势。
    • 应用场景:Vue.js适用于构建单页面应用(SPA)和复杂的前端交互界面。
    • 腾讯云相关产品:腾讯云提供了云开发(CloudBase)服务,可用于快速搭建和部署Vue.js应用。详情请参考腾讯云云开发
  • Inertia.js:
    • 概念:Inertia.js是一种现代化的服务器端渲染(SSR)解决方案,用于构建无刷新的、快速响应的Web应用程序。
    • 分类:Inertia.js属于前后端分离开发框架,用于提供无刷新的用户体验。
    • 优势:Inertia.js具有简化开发流程、提高性能、减少前后端代码重复等优势。
    • 应用场景:Inertia.js适用于需要快速响应和无刷新体验的Web应用程序。
    • 腾讯云相关产品:腾讯云无特定产品与Inertia.js相关联。
  • Laravel:
    • 概念:Laravel是一种流行的PHP Web应用程序框架,提供了简洁优雅的语法和丰富的功能,用于快速构建高质量的Web应用程序。
    • 分类:Laravel属于后端开发框架,用于处理业务逻辑和数据操作。
    • 优势:Laravel具有简单易学、开发效率高、功能丰富、安全性好等优势。
    • 应用场景:Laravel适用于构建各种规模的Web应用程序,包括企业级应用和小型网站。
    • 腾讯云相关产品:腾讯云提供了云服务器(CVM)和云数据库(CDB)等产品,可用于部署和运行Laravel应用。详情请参考腾讯云云服务器腾讯云云数据库

对于使用Vue.js / Inertia.js和Laravel对结果进行分页的具体实现,可以参考以下步骤:

  1. 前端实现:
    • 使用Vue.js构建前端页面,通过组件化的方式实现分页功能。
    • 使用Inertia.js与后端进行通信,获取分页数据。
    • 在前端页面中展示分页数据,并提供翻页功能。
  • 后端实现:
    • 使用Laravel框架处理前端请求,包括获取分页数据和处理翻页请求。
    • 通过数据库查询或其他方式获取需要分页的数据。
    • 根据前端请求的页码和每页显示数量,返回对应的分页数据。

通过以上步骤,可以实现使用Vue.js / Inertia.js和Laravel对结果进行分页的功能。这种方式可以提供良好的用户体验和性能优化,同时实现前后端分离开发,提高开发效率。

请注意,以上答案中没有提及亚马逊AWS、Azure、阿里云、华为云、天翼云、GoDaddy、Namecheap、Google等流行的云计算品牌商,如有需要,可以自行参考相关文档和产品介绍。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

1分28秒

JSP医药进销存管理系统myeclipse开发SQLServer数据库web结构java编程

1分53秒

JSP贸易管理系统myeclipse开发mysql数据库struts编程java语言

1分34秒

JSP期末考试安排管理系统myeclipse开发mysql数据库web结构java编程

1分3秒

JSP企业办公管理系统myeclipse开发SQLServer数据库web结构java编程

6分33秒

088.sync.Map的比较相关方法

1分25秒

JSP票据管理系统myeclipse开发mysql数据库web结构java编程

1分48秒

JSP库存管理系统myeclipse开发SQLServer数据库web结构java编程

27秒

JSP美容管理系统系统myeclipse开发mysql数据库web结构java编程

1分48秒

智慧港口视频智能分析系统解决方案

5分17秒

集成电路IC:解析探测器模块的工作原理与特点,模块测试座的重要作用

2分30秒

JSP SH论文答辩管理系统myeclipse开发mysql数据库mvc结构java编程

11分45秒

开启智能未来的关键:无线通信模组之无线传感器芯片的应用与测试座解析

领券